Matías Bosch
Matías Bosch is a notable researcher and advocate for workers' rights in the Dominican Republic. He co-authored a recent study highlighting the disparity in income distribution in the country, revealing that Dominican workers receive only 22% of the GDP in compensation. His work emphasizes the need for organized labor movements to address economic injustices and promote equitable wealth distribution.
